Columbus, Richmond Move On To Finals
ABL playoffs
Nikki McCray scored 25 points as visiting Columbus defeated San Jose 81-69 Tuesday night to advance to the finals of the inaugural American Basketball League championship.
The Quest will play Richmond in a best-of-5 series, which will begin Sunday in Columbus.
Columbus advanced to the finals by sweeping San Jose in the best-of-3 semifinals.
The teams were tied at 13 after the first quarter, but the Quest (33-9) went on an 11-0 run during the second period and led 38-22 at halftime.
Richmond 82, Colorado 66
Adrienne Goodson and Marta Sobral each scored 18 points Tuesday as the Richmond Rage built a 20-point halftime lead en route to a victory over the Colorado Xplosion at Denver for a 2-0 sweep in the ABL semifinal series.
Richmond had come from behind to beat the Xplosion 80-77 in the series opener Sunday. Tuesday the Rage jumped out to a 15-2 lead and the Xplosion never challenged.
The Colorado team set team lows for its 7-point first quarter, 21-point first half and 66-point total.
